WhatsApp has introduced a new feature called Group Message History, designed to reduce confusion and interruptions in group conversations. The feature allows newly added members to view recent messages that were sent before they joined the group. This update simplifies onboarding in professional, community, and personal chats while maintaining WhatsApp’s strong end-to-end encryption standards.
Previously, when a user was added to a WhatsApp group, they could only see messages sent after joining. This often resulted in misunderstandings or required other members to manually forward older messages for context. With the new Group Message History feature, administrators can now optionally share selected past messages directly within the group.
What is WhatsApp Group Message History?
In its official blog announcement, WhatsApp explained that Group Message History allows group admins to decide whether new participants can access previous conversations. The feature is optional and configurable, giving administrators complete control.
Admins can:
- Choose whether to share past messages
- Decide how many messages to share (starting from as few as 25 messages)
- Enable or disable the feature based on group type
This flexibility makes it suitable for corporate teams, study groups, community organisations, and family chats.
Privacy & Encryption Safeguards
WhatsApp has emphasised that the new feature does not compromise privacy. All shared messages remain protected under end-to-end encryption (E2EE), ensuring that only group participants can access them.
Key privacy highlights include:
- Message history remains encrypted
- Only group members can view shared content
- Admins control message visibility
- No weakening of existing encryption protocols
This ensures that WhatsApp continues to uphold its privacy-first approach while introducing new functionality.
Transparency Features
To maintain transparency within groups, WhatsApp has introduced the following safeguards:
- Group members receive a notification when message history is shared
- Shared messages include timestamps and sender information
- Message history appears visually distinct from regular chat messages
This helps users easily identify forwarded historical messages from real-time conversations.

Availability and Rollout
WhatsApp has started the global rollout of the Group Message History feature. It will be available on both Android and iOS devices. Users are advised to update their WhatsApp application to the latest version via Google Play Store or Apple App Store to access the feature.
